Do you have what it takes to become a Peggle master? Found out as you navigate a series of ball-bouncing challenges in Peggle Dual Shot for Nintendo DS from PopCap Games and lauded developer Q Entertainment. You’ll need luck and skill on your side to score your best as you bounce balls, perfect tricky shots, and engage with real Masters in this action-packed, family-friendly game. .caption { font…
